How can I search within content using eDiscovery?
To perform a content-based search using eDiscovery Advanced, ensure the following:
-
Configure content indexing during add-on setup
- After purchasing the eDiscovery metadata and content search add-on, enable content indexing while configuring the add-on. This ensures the actual content of files, emails, chats, and records is indexed for search.
-
Enable content search in the search filters page
- While performing a search, check the option "Enable content search" in the eDiscovery search page. This allows the search to include the indexed content.
